LondonMetric Property Plc (LON:LMP - Get Free Report)'s stock price hit a new 52-week low during mid-day trading on Monday . The company traded as low as GBX 170.40 ($2.23) and last traded at GBX 170.46 ($2.23), with a volume of 11987472 shares trading hands. The stock had previously closed at GBX 180.40 ($2.36).

The firm has a 50-day moving average of GBX 183.02 and a 200 day moving average of GBX 186.95. The company has a market cap of £3.70 billion, a P/E ratio of 18.75,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 3.27 and a beta of 0.90. The company has a current ratio of 0.68, a quick ratio of 0.81 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 53.84.
